Those are interesting suggestions.....


some might work and others ignore a host of economic, political and geographical realities that make them either unworkable or a long term project dependent on other things needing to happen first. Either way a good post and plenty of food for thought and discussion. Would probably make a lot of sense to copy and give the post its own thread as opposed to being buried in this one, just my opinion.

#1 would be nice but, ignores the difference in reality of what FSU's bargaining position was in the ACC and what VT's is and wholly ignores the possibility that where the conference is now might require a little more diplomacy than big stick. #2 is a very good suggestion but, rather than VT demanding it must be a coalition of schools for a reasonable chance of success to overcome the Tobacco Road voting block and behind the scenes power brokers. #3 is a good suggestion and there may be workable alternatives in addition. I doubt publicly complaining will be as productive as building consensus behind the scenes, at least initially. 4 and 5 are minefields that may hurt other more useful suggestions and will probably work themselves out on their own in the long run. VT does not want to shoot itself in the foot or sacrifice political capital on those, in my opinion. Disagree with #6 in principle as Raycom is a long time conference partner and deserves to be treated fairly. Agree on the nepotism angle but, with senior gone junior's influence would probably be minimal and more important is preventing future occurrence. #7 will occur in the normal course of evolution and as opposed to pushing and creating unintended consequences or enemies the ACC will be better served, in my opinion, influencing behind the scenes and being prepared to adapt concurrently with the shifting landscape.
